Join the power movement as an Accounts Payable Specialist

As an Accounts Payable Specialist, you will be responsible for ensuring the company's bills are paid timely and accurately to keep our world-changing project on track! In this role, you will coordinate the processing and payment of our supplier invoices, help in identifying accruals for contractors, and assist with our monthly accounting close process. You will coordinate directly with stakeholders within the business as well as with our external suppliers to ensure a smooth payment process. We're a quick-moving organization in our pursuit of clean, fusion energy, and we're looking for folks that can keep organized while remaining flexible in a rapidly evolving work environment. Strong attention to detail is critical for this role to ensure our records are accurate. This role reports to the Accounts Payable Supervisor.

What you'll do:

  • Execute accounts payable function in a high-volume and dynamic working environment (entering, processing, and paying invoices)
  • Maintain detailed electronic records to support accounts payable transactions for compliance and annual audit
  • Coordinate in a prompt and professional manner with procurement, receiving, budget owners, and external suppliers to facilitate the prompt resolution of outstanding transactions, invoice holds, and payment issues
  • Monitor accounts payable workflow ensuring appropriate approval authority, general ledger coding, and compliance with company internal controls, policies, and procedures
  • Strong organizational, analytical and time management skills
  • Prepare and distribute 1099s to appropriate vendors and file with IRS
  • Reconcile vendor statements and resolve any outstanding issues
  • Perform additional assignments per supervisor’s direction
  • Review and Process Non-Po Invoices, verify the GL account, and send them for approval
